The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S) Transformation task force is actively seeking input from within the Government and from industry with respect to ideas for improvements to the DFARS and the process by which the DFARS is written. The Office of the Secretary of Defense (OSD) has established a Web site to collect ideas from interested parties. The task force is truly open to any and all ideas, and we highly encourage you to take advantage of this opportunity to submit your ideas individually via the Web site at http:://www.acq.osd.mil/dp/dars//transf.htm.

Although the initial deadline has passed for submission of proposals, the task force will continue to collect proposals for consideration. Further, proposals will continue to be posted on the DFARS Transformation Web site so that you may view all improvement proposals submitted to date and so you can see what others within the government and industry are recommending.
